Definition of homeostasis. * Maintaining a stable internal environment for optimal cell function. * Conditions regulated include temperature, pH, glucose, and water levels. 2. How homeostasis responds to changes. * Adapting to both internal and external environmental conditions. 3. Automatic control systems in the body. * The general mechanism for maintaining balance. * Key components: Receptors, coordination centres, and effectors. 4. Communication within control systems. * The role of the nervous system (using fast electrical impulses via nerves). * The role of the endocrine system (using hormones transported in the bloodstream). 5.
